Geant4  v4-10.4-release
 모두 클래스 네임스페이스들 파일들 함수 변수 타입정의 열거형 타입 열거형 멤버 Friends 매크로 그룹들 페이지들
네임스페이스 | 매크로 | 함수 | 변수
G4INCLGlobals.hh 파일 참조
#include "globals.hh"
#include <cmath>
#include <string>
#include <vector>
#include "G4INCLParticleType.hh"

이 파일의 소스 코드 페이지로 가기

네임스페이스

 G4INCL
 
 G4INCL::PhysicalConstants
 
 G4INCL::Math
 
 G4INCL::ParticleConfig
 

매크로

#define INCLXX_IN_GEANT4_MODE   1
 
#define G4INCLGlobals_hh   1
 

함수

G4double G4INCL::Math::toDegrees (G4double radians)
 
G4int G4INCL::Math::heaviside (G4int n)
 
G4double G4INCL::Math::pow13 (G4double x)
 
G4double G4INCL::Math::powMinus13 (G4double x)
 
G4double G4INCL::Math::pow23 (G4double x)
 
G4double G4INCL::Math::aSinH (G4double x)
 
template<typename T >
G4int G4INCL::Math::sign (const T t)
 
template<typename T >
G4INCL::Math::max (const T t1, const T t2)
 brief Return the largest of the two arguments 더 자세히 ...
 
template<typename T >
G4INCL::Math::min (const T t1, const T t2)
 brief Return the smallest of the two arguments 더 자세히 ...
 
G4double G4INCL::Math::gaussianCDF (const G4double x)
 Cumulative distribution function for Gaussian. 더 자세히 ...
 
G4double G4INCL::Math::gaussianCDF (const G4double x, const G4double x0, const G4double sigma)
 Generic cumulative distribution function for Gaussian. 더 자세히 ...
 
G4double G4INCL::Math::inverseGaussianCDF (const G4double x)
 Inverse cumulative distribution function for Gaussian. 더 자세히 ...
 
G4double G4INCL::Math::arcSin (const G4double x)
 Calculates arcsin with some tolerance on illegal arguments. 더 자세히 ...
 
G4double G4INCL::Math::arcCos (const G4double x)
 Calculates arccos with some tolerance on illegal arguments. 더 자세히 ...
 
G4bool G4INCL::ParticleConfig::isPair (Particle const *const p1, Particle const *const p2, ParticleType t1, ParticleType t2)
 

변수

const G4double G4INCL::PhysicalConstants::hc = 197.328
 \(\hbar c\) [MeV*fm] 더 자세히 ...
 
const G4double G4INCL::PhysicalConstants::hcSquared = hc*hc
 \(\hbar^2 c^2\) [MeV^2*fm^2] 더 자세히 ...
 
const G4double G4INCL::PhysicalConstants::Pf = 1.37*hc
 Fermi momentum [MeV/c]. 더 자세히 ...
 
const G4double G4INCL::PhysicalConstants::eSquared = 1.439964
 Coulomb conversion factor [MeV*fm]. 더 자세히 ...
 
const G4double G4INCL::Math::pi = 3.14159265358979323846264338328
 
const G4double G4INCL::Math::twoPi = 2.0 * pi
 
const G4double G4INCL::Math::tenPi = 10.0 * pi
 
const G4double G4INCL::Math::piOverTwo = 0.5 * pi
 
const G4double G4INCL::Math::oneOverSqrtTwo = 1./std::sqrt((G4double)2.)
 
const G4double G4INCL::Math::oneOverSqrtThree = 1./std::sqrt((G4double)3.)
 
const G4double G4INCL::Math::oneThird = 1./3.
 
const G4double G4INCL::Math::twoThirds = 2./3.
 
const G4double G4INCL::Math::sqrtFiveThirds = std::sqrt(5./3.)
 
const G4double G4INCL::Math::sqrtThreeFifths = std::sqrt(3./5.)
 

매크로 문서화

#define G4INCLGlobals_hh   1

G4INCLGlobals.hh 파일의 39 번째 라인에서 정의되었습니다.

#define INCLXX_IN_GEANT4_MODE   1

G4INCLGlobals.hh 파일의 34 번째 라인에서 정의되었습니다.